Hi,I have a 66 dart gt w/ 7 1/4 rear end. I bought an 8 3/4 housing w/ backing plates & axles and brake drums It is the small bolt pattern. I need all the parts for the brakes. ie, shoes, springs, wheel cylinders, everything.. Is there somewhere I can buy a kit w/everything I need or am I going to have to buy piece by piece??? and if so, does anyone know where I can find the complete list of everything i need??? As for a list of what you need:

wheel cylinders (2)
brake hardware kit
adjuster kit
shoes

It's been my experience that the kits will usually have enough parts to do both sides, but check with your parts guy.

(and get your drums checked by a trusted local shop and see if they are round or need to be cut a few thousandths.)

measure your drum width before you buy parts. if the brakes are original A body (which I assume they are since you said small bolt pattern) the shoes will be 1-3/4" IIRC. Some of the brake hardware will be different than the non A body 8-3/4 pieces, not just the shoes.
RockAuto should be a good source for most if not all of your needs.
 
You're probably going to have to find the arms that connect to the parking brake cables & the spreaders (don't know what else to call them) that fit across between the brake shoes used. Don't know of any suppliers of these parts new unless Mopar has them.
 
Just did this same job,Parts that could NOT be had at local part stores including NAPA are. E- BRAKE STRUT BAR bar goes front to rear connecting both shoes togather. E-BRAKE CABLE LEVER,connects cable to rear shoe. The oval washer retainer that holds the shoes on the pivot. And last are those little slotted dowels that fit between the shoe and the wheel cylinder piston. Slick

If you have a SBP 8 3/4 factory A body rear, you have 10 X 1.75 rear brakes.
